RBI to conduct Reverse Repo and MSF Operations on RTGS-working-Mumbai Holidays
In order to facilitate better liquidity management by the market participants and to align the liquidity operations with the working of payment systems, Reserve Bank of India has decided to conduct Reverse Repo and MSF operations on all Mumbai holidays when the RTGS is open. This change will come into effect from February 19, 2016. The timings of the Reverse Repo / MSF operations will be between 5:30 pm and 7: 30 pm on such holidays. Ajit Prasad Assistant Adviser Pres

RBI makes its Master Direction on Gold Monetization Scheme more customer-friendly
The Reserve Bank of India has today made a few amendments to its Master Direction on Gold Monetization Scheme. The modifications have been made in consultation with Central Government to make the Scheme more customer-friendly. The depositors will be able to withdraw medium term and long term government deposits pre-maturely after the minimum lock-in period of three years in the case of medium term deposits and after five years in the case of long term deposits.
